My holster type case is damaging the screen on my TP2.
http://forum.ppcgeeks.com/attachment...1&d=1255277515 I see two dark horizontal bands on my screen, when I look at it from more then a 30 degree angle. You can see this with the screen off or on (although you can't see it unless it is against a white background when the screen is on). At first I thought I might have squeeged two hard when I put on a screen protector. But I just figured out that my case has ridges in it where the belt loops press against it. The irony here is that I have always put my screen inward in the case to help protect it more. I will keep the screen outward from now on. |
